Reports: Up to Half of Elder Scrolls Online Development Team Laid Off at ZeniMax

Summary

Recent reports claim that ZeniMax Online Studios has laid off up to half of the team supporting The Elder Scrolls Online, the twelve-year-old MMORPG. This has sparked concern given the game's recent operational turnaround and established roadmap. The studio has faced redundancies and player base fluctuations over the past year, and these latest cuts threaten the game's future stability.
